T-Mobile G1 v2 “Bigfoot” gets pictured
The Boy Genius Report just published a report an image of the T-Mobile G1 v2 – codenamed T-Mobile Bigfoot or T-Mobile Morrison. The T-Mobile G1 v2 Bigfoot, as it’s named, is apparently a re-tooled version of the first-generation T-Mobile Android phone. Boy Genius explained the next-gen T-Mobile G1 has got its name as Bigfoot and it supposedly seems to continue the practice of having a slide-out QWERTY. The phone have a much thinner, sleeker design with chrome accents and a black front not unlike its Apple rival. It would also have dedicated ringer and volume switches. Moreover, the phone will apparently feature a 5 megapixel camera instead of a 3.2 megapixel one

BGR also said that The Bigfoot handsetdue in October from T-Mobile will retail for about $149.99 with a 2 year contract. It should be available also via Walmart for about the same price.
